Responsibilities

  • Record trust and operating bank deposits daily
  • Process company accounts payable to carriers via check/EFT
  • Ensure timely processing of carrier payables
  • Complete bank reconciliations
  • Reconcile carrier statements against internal records monthly
  • Investigate and resolve discrepancies, including commission differences
  • Prepare journal entries and account reconciliations during month-end close
  • Support audits and ad-hoc reporting requests
  • Assist with process improvements, automation, and system enhancements
  • Perform additional projects and research as needed.
